The Danish Agency for International Recruitment and Integration (SIRI)

The Danish Agency for International Recruitment and Integration (SIRI) is an agency under the Danish Ministry of Immigration and Integration.

We process applications concerning residence and work permits from third-country citizens who wish to reside in Denmark, Greenland or the Faroe Islands, in order to work or study. Furthermore, we also issue residence documents to EU/EEA citizens, and are responsible for verification within the area of immigration.

At SIRI, we also provide guidance to municipalities and other operators, on how to properly receive and integrate refugees and reunified families. This is done e.g. via Danish language lessons, employment oriented initiatives, and funds provided for vulnerable families. Furthermore, we also provide guidance to municipalities and other operators, on how to prevent honour-related conflicts and negative social control.

We are either responsible or co-responsible for a number of networks and forums, wherein which we collaborate with companies, educational institutions, organizations, municipalities, authorities etc. Here, we are focused on recruiting highly qualified foreigners, as well as supporting the municipal efforts regarding integration and prevention.
